Sienicki Artur I7X6S1 Modelowanie Matematyczne
TREŚĆ ZADANIA:
Firma Intel pracuje nad procesorem nowej generacji. LZ zespołów składających się z LP
pracowników jest odpowiedzialnych za wytworzenie X elementów procesora. Do zespołów
przydzielani są specjaliści posiadający określone kwalifikacje. Aby praca przebiegała bez
\adnych przeszkód \aden z pracowników nie mo\e pracować w więcej ni\ jednym zespole.
Czas wykonania poszczególnego komponentu przez zespół wynosi Tij, a czas wykonania
całego procesora szacuje się na Trz. Firma Intel podkreśliła fakt, i\ prace nad ka\dym
komponentem procesora nie będą trwały jednocześnie. Dopiero kiedy jeden element zostanie
wykonany, mo\na rozpocząć pracę nad drugim ze względu na fakt, i\ pracownicy biorą
udział równie\ w innym projekcieWyznaczono równie\ bud\et, który mo\na przeznaczyć na
produkcję procesora Kmax. Zatem koszt wykonania poszczególnego elementu procesora
przez zespół będzie wynosił Kij, a rzeczywisty koszt projektu wyniesie Krz. Aączny czas pracy
nad procesorem nowej generacji nie mo\e przekroczyć Tmax. Nale\y tak zorganizować prace
nadnowym procesorem, by czas wykonania był jak najmniejszy oraz koszty poniesione przez
korporacje były minimalne i tym samym nie przekroczyły dostępnego bud\etu.
LP liczba zatrudnionych pracowników
LZ liczba zespołów pracujących nad nowym procesorem
LPD liczba komponentów
X zbiór numerów komponentów do wykonania X ‚" 2N , X {i " Ni : i< Z}
Xi zbiór numerów podzespołów do wykonania przez zespół i
PR zbiór numerów wszystkich pracowników pracujących nad projektem
Pi zbiór numerów pracowników z zespołu i
Zz zbiór numerów wszystkich zespołów
NKW zbiór numerów kwalifikacji potrzebnych do pracy nad procesorem
NKWi zbiór numerów kwalifikacji i-tego pracownika
NKPi zbiór numerów kwalifikacji potrzebnych do wykonania i-tego elementu
Tij czas wykonania i-tego elementu przez j-ty zespół
Trz rzeczywisty czas wykonania całego procesora
Tmax maksymalny czas przeznaczony na wykonanie całego procesora
Kmax bud\et przeznaczony na produkcjÄ™ procesora
Kij koszt wykonania i-tego komponentu przez j-ty zespół
Krz rzeczywiste koszty poniesione podczas produkcji procesora
OBJAŚNIENIE KOLORÓW:
Na czerwono zaznaczono zbiory mo\liwych (fizycznie) do uzyskania wartości. Decydent w chwili
podejmowania decyzji będzie znał wartości danych, rozkład ich prawopodobieństw, stopień
przynale\ności jej wartości do zbioru, ale znane będzie jedynie przybli\enie zbioru.
Na zielono zaś te cechy, na których wartości zale\y decydentowi i na które nie ma wpływu przez co
posiada niepełna znajomość danych.
1
Sienicki Artur I7X6S1 Modelowanie Matematyczne
OPIS CECH:
Å„Å‚ üÅ‚
LZ LZ
ôÅ‚ ôÅ‚
LP, N , LZ, N , LPD, N , X ,2N ,{X ,2N i=1}, PR,2N ,{Pi ,2N i=1}, Z ,2N , NKW ,2N ,
i z
ôÅ‚ ôÅ‚
O
LZ
LP LPD LPD
ôÅ‚ ôÅ‚
Å„Å‚ üÅ‚,
= {NKWi ,2N i=1},{NKWPi ,2N i=1 }, {Tij , R+ i=1 } Trz , R+ , Tmax , R+ , Kmax , R+ , Krz , R+ ,żł
òÅ‚ òÅ‚ żł
X
j=1
ół þÅ‚
ôÅ‚ ôÅ‚
LZ
ôÅ‚Å„Å‚ ôÅ‚
LPD
üÅ‚
{Kij , R+ i=1 }
ôÅ‚òÅ‚ żł ôÅ‚
j=1
ół þÅ‚
ół þÅ‚
OPIS ZWIZKÓW:
O
= { Z1,Y1, R1 , Z2 ,Y2 , R2 , Z3,Y3, R3 , Z4 ,Y4, R4 , Z5,Y5, R5 , Z6 ,Y6 , R6 }
R
Z1: jeden pracownik mo\e pracować w jednym zespole
LZ
Y1 = LZ, Z ,{Pi}
z
i=1
Å„Å‚ üÅ‚
ôÅ‚
lz
R1 = lz, zz ,{pi} " N × (2N )1+lz : za )" zb = "ôÅ‚
òÅ‚ żł
i=1 "
a,b"Zz
ôÅ‚ ôÅ‚
a`"b
ół þÅ‚
Z2: rzeczywisty czas wykonania całego projektu
LZ
LPD LZ
Y2 = LZ , LPD , Z ,Trz ,{{Tij} } ,{X }
z i
i=1
i=1
j =1
Å„Å‚ lz üÅ‚
lpd lz
2 N 2 N
R2 = lz,lpd , z ,trz ,{{t } } ,{xi} " N × 2 × R+ × (2 )lz : trz = tij żł
òÅ‚
z ij " "
i=1
i=1
j =1
j"Zz i"Xj
ół þÅ‚
Z3: ograniczenie na czas wykonania całego procesora
Y3 = Trz ,Tmax
2
R3 = {trz ,tmax " R+ : trz d" tmax}
Z4: rzeczywisty koszt poniesiony przy produkcji nowego procesora
LZ
LPD LZ
Y4 = LPD, LZ, Z ,Trz ,{{Tij} } ,{X }
z i
i=1
i=1
j=1
Å„Å‚ lz üÅ‚
lpd lz
2 2
R4 = lpd,lz, zz ,trz ,{{tij} } ,{xi} " N × 2N × R+ × (2N )lz : krz =
òÅ‚ żł
" "kij
i=1
i=1
j=1
j"Zz i"Xj
ół þÅ‚
Z5: ograniczenie na koszt nie mo\na przekroczyć dostępnego bud\etu
Y5 = Krz , Kmax
2
R5 = {krz , kmax " R+ : krz d" kmax}
2
Sienicki Artur I7X6S1 Modelowanie Matematyczne
Z6: powodzenie wykonania ka\dego elementu
LZ LP LPD LZ
Y6 = LP, LPD, LZ, Z ,{Pi} ,{NKWi} ,{NKWPi} ,{X }
z i
i=1 i=1 i=1 i=1
Å„Å‚ üÅ‚
lz lp lpd lz
3
R6 = lp,lpd,lz, zz ,{pi} ,{nkwi} ,{nkwpi} ,{xi} " N × (2N )1+lz+lp+lpd +lz : nkwi ƒ" nkwpi żł
òÅ‚
U U
i=1 i=1 i=1 i=1 "
j"Pz
i"Pj k"Xj
ół þÅ‚
LZ LZ
LZ LP LPD LPD LPD
a = LP, LZ, LPD, X , PR,{Pi} , Z , NKW ,{NKWi} ,{NKWPi} ,{{Tij} } ,Tmax , Kmax ,{{Kij} }
z
i=1 i=1 i=1
i=1 i=1
j=1 j=1
w = Trz , Krz
LZ
x = {X }
i
i=1
gdzie:
a lista danych
w lista wskazników
x lista zmiennych decyzyjnych
LZ LZ
LZ LP LPD LPD LPD
Å„Å‚ üÅ‚
LP, LZ, LPD, X , PR,{Pi} , Z , NKW ,{NKWi} ,{NKWPi} , {{Tij} } ,Tmax , Kmax ,{{Kij} }
z
i=1 i=1 i=1
i=1 i=1
j=1 j=1
ôÅ‚ ôÅ‚
ôÅ‚ ôÅ‚
3 +2+LP+LPD 4
× R+ :
ôÅ‚" N × (2N )2+LZ ôÅ‚
ôÅ‚ ôÅ‚
A =
òÅ‚ Z z = LZ, PR = LP, X = LPD, NKWi ‚" NKW , żł
i
" "NKWP ‚" NKW ,
ôÅ‚ ôÅ‚
i"PR i"X
ôÅ‚ ôÅ‚
" "
ôÅ‚i,m"Zz Zi )" Zm = ", i"Zz Pi ‚" PR ôÅ‚
ôÅ‚i`"m ôÅ‚
ół þÅ‚
Å„Å‚ üÅ‚
2
W (a, x) = Trz , Krz " R+ : Trz = , Krz =
òÅ‚ żł
" "Tij " "Kij
j"Zz i"Xj j"Zz i"Xj
ół þÅ‚
LZ
Å„Å‚
{X } " (2N )LZ : d" Kmax , d" Tmax , X ‚" X , üÅ‚
i " "Kij " "Tij j
i=1 "
ôÅ‚ ôÅ‚
j"Zz
j"Zz i"Xj j"Zz i"Xj
&!(a) =
òÅ‚ żł
NKWPi ‚" NKWk
ôÅ‚ ôÅ‚
U U
"
j"Zz
i"Xj k"Zj
ół þÅ‚
3
Sienicki Artur I7X6S1 Modelowanie Matematyczne
SFORMUAOWANIE ZADANIA OPTYMALIZACJI:
*
Dla danych a" A nale\y wyznaczyć takie x "&!(a) aby "y* "W (a, x) : Ea ( y*) = 1:
* *
Å„Å‚
minT min
ôÅ‚1 gdy y = x"&!(a) rz (x) oraz Ea (y*) = Å„Å‚
ôÅ‚1 gdy y = x"&!(a) Krz (x)
Ea (y*) =
òÅ‚ òÅ‚
ôÅ‚ ôÅ‚
ół0 w p.p ół0 w p.p
gdzie:
Trz (x) =
" "Tij
j"Zz i"Xj
Krz (x) =
" "Kij
j"Zz i"Xj
SFORMUAOWANIE ZADANIA EKSTREMALIZACJI:
*
Dla danych a" A nale\y wyznaczyć takie x "&!(a) aby Krz (x*) = Krz (x) oraz
min
x"&!(a)
Trz (x* ) =
rz
minT (x)
x"&!(a)
4
Wyszukiwarka
Podobne podstrony:
zadanie domowe zestawZadania Domowe (seria IV)Zadania Domowe (seria V)Zadania domowe ISD kolokwium nr 22RP II Zadania Domowezadanie domoweZadania Domowe (seria IX) p1Zadania domowe z przedmiotu Podstawy AutomatykiStyczna rozniczka zadania domoweZadanie domowe 2004wyklad14 zadania domoweZadania domowe 8więcej podobnych podstron